360CITIES (www.360cities.net)

www.360cities.net

There are thousands of stunning 360 degrees images from across the globe on 360cities.net, including many of the best tourist attractions.

Take a look at the editor's picks and the most popular posts on the site's homepage.

To find a more specific destination, click on the world map which has an interface similar to Google Earth.

Users can also embed their own images for non-commercial use.

SEATGURU (www.seatguru.com)

www.seatguru.com

This site from the people at the travel site Trip Advisor shares information on the differences between airline seats.

It lists the contacts for all the major airlines and displays interactive seating charts.

Users can see diagrams of the plane models, with clear and full descriptions of where the good seats and the bad seats are.

THE QUOTE BLOG (www.thequoteblog.com)

www.thequoteblog.com

This is a good blog to bookmark for anyone wanting a library of smart things to say.

The "interesting quotes by interesting people" section has picked up some nuggets from an eclectic group of celebrities.

But there are also quotes from famous figures such as Abraham Lincoln, Ernest Hemingway, Aristotle, and Socrates among others.
